What is Kami?
Kami are spirits, gods, or divine forces present in all aspects of nature, including trees, rivers, mountains, animals, and even human ancestors.
What is a peninsula? Where peninsula in Asia do we study? What two countries are on this peninsula?
A peninsula is a piece of land that is surrounded by water on three sides but connected to a larger landmass. Korean Peninsula, North Korea and South Korea.
What is a monsoon?
A monsoon is a seasonal wind pattern that brings heavy rain.

What is Confucianism?
A philosophy based on moral values, social harmony, and the importance of proper relationships.
What are the main beliefs of Confucianism?
The key beliefs include respect for family, importance of education, moral behavior, and rituals to maintain social harmony.
